Green Super Lunch Smoothie

1-2 cups spinach leaves
1 banana
1/2 cup blueberries
2 tbs. hemp seeds
1 tsp. maca powder -optional
1/2 tsp. chlorella
1 tbs ground flax seeds
Unsweetened Almond Milk

400 calories
High in Omega Oils, Vitamins A, B6, C, High in manganese, magnesium, potassium, high in Fiber and contains around 13grams of protein. Not to mention all the greens and chlorella help to remove heavy metals from the system.

So my daily routine for the first week was some kind of fruit juice for breakfast like cantaloupe juice (my personal fav)or a nice apple, fennel, ginger or a carrot, apple, beet juice. Really the sky's the limit depending on your personal likes. For lunch I would have my Super Smoothie then I would have a light afternoon juice usually something like apple, cucumber, celery, kale or apple, lemon, red cabbage (pink lemonade:). And for dinner a nice vegetable juice like parsnip, tomato, cucumber, celery, red pepper, garlic/ginger. An important thing to remember with juicing is that you want to limit your intake of sweet root vegetables and fruits in the afternoon evening as the sugar found in these foods will keep you up.
